What precisely is lymphatic drainage therapeutic massage? 

A part of our immune system, the lymphatic system is accountable for carrying waste and toxins away from (and bringing vitamins to) each cell within the physique. However in contrast to the circulatory system, the lymphatic system doesn’t have a pump. It depends on issues like motion and breath, so it may well simply turn into stagnant, which may result in pimples, puffiness, and dry, uninteresting pores and skin.

“Lymphatic drainage therapeutic massage is a sort of therapeutic massage that encourages the pure drainage of lymph by manually urgent and massaging the pores and skin at sure areas, urgent within the path of the guts,” Dorn explains. “As lymph carries waste merchandise from the tissues, it returns them to the guts to be purified and eliminated.”

Dorn notes that whereas a lymphatic drainage facial therapeutic massage could be completed by a licensed skilled, an alternate model could be completed by your self at residence.

How can you tell when you need lymphatic drainage?

Because it doesn’t have a pump to keep things moving, it’s easy for our lymphatic system to get backed up. “So even if there are no noticeable signs like puffiness, anyone can benefit from a lymphatic drainage massage, as it encourages the movement of lymph and ensures that this fluid doesn’t get backed up,” Dorn adds.

How long will it take to see results from a lymphatic drainage face massage?

Our pros unanimously gave our favorite beauty answer: immediately.

“However, the effects of the massage will vary from person to person,” Vargas notes. “If you have a very backed up lymphatic system, you may not notice benefits for a few sessions. If you have very little or no blockage in your system, you may not notice any observable benefits at all. In either case, the massage will encourage the movement of lymph, which carries with it toxins that could otherwise negatively affect your system. This has tremendous benefits for your health and immunity.”

Lymphatic Drainage Massage Best Practices

“It only takes three minutes, so commit to doing it every day for 21 days so that it becomes a habit.” — Dr. Ritu Chopra

“When using a wand, start along the side of the neck to mimic a lymphatic drainage massage and then go from middle to the sides of the face in order to deliver the best result.” — Joanna Vargas

“Be sure to use sufficient pressure and always move in one direction, towards the lymph nodes.” — Dr. Ritu Chopra

And for a hands-on technique to encourage the lymphatic system to drain all through the body, Jordan Dorn shares a few helpful steps.

  • Take 10 slow and deep breaths in and out, filling and emptying your lungs completely with each breath. This helps move lymph fluid through your lymph vessels and lymph nodes.
  • Using a dry brush, brush your skin toward the direction of your heart, repeating each stroke a few times.
  • Place the index and middle fingers of each hand on either side of your neck, just below your earlobe. Stretch the skin by gently sliding the fingers down toward the shoulders, then release. Repeat five times.
  • Cup your palm under your armpits and gently press up toward your shoulder 10 times.
  • Cup your palms under your knees and gently press up 10 times.

How to Do a Lymphatic Drainage Massage at Home

For a step-by-step tutorial of manual lymphatic drainage massage, we spoke with Gianna de La Torre, acupuncturist and co-founder of Wildling, a holistic magnificence model that focuses on lovely, thoughtfully-crafted instruments for time-tested pores and skin rituals. Beneath, Gianna shares suggestions, directions, and particular therapeutic massage methods that will help you get probably the most out of your at-home lymphatic therapeutic massage.

1. Detoxify + Dry Brush

  • Dry brushing stimulates lymphatic circulation and warms up the tissues for gua sha. Use earlier than a bathe. Assume up the limbs and down the core.
  • Utilizing mild quick upward strokes beginning at your ankles and transferring up your leg (consider motions such as you’re shaving). 
  • Subsequent, do the identical movement transferring from wrists to shoulders.
  • Observe with mild round strokes in a clockwise movement across the abdomen (beginning out of your proper facet, excessive of your stomach button, and down the left facet).
  • End your core with downwards strokes from shoulders to the groin.

2. Moisturize

  • Moisturize along with your favourite physique oil (we love the OSEA Undaria Algae Body Oil). This creates slip and ensures the instrument will slide throughout the physique somewhat than pulling.

3. Launch + Clean

  • Following the dry brush steps along with your gua sha or physique instrument, use upward strokes from ankle up over the bum, from wrist to shoulder.
  • Transfer to your chest and do rounded strokes over and beneath every breast transferring in the direction of the armpits.
  • Repeat the round motions across the abdomen.
  • End with strokes across the core, transferring from shoulder to the groin.
